Instalacja systemu MacOSx
na komputerze PC.
Co bedzie nam potrzebne:
–
Komputer z procesorem Intel (z obsługą SSE2/SEE3) oraz płyta gówna z
mostkiem północym co najmniej ICH-7 (wszystkie chipsety kompatybilne
wzwyż, z wyłączeniem chipsetu Sandy Bridge). Można zainstalować na
procesorach AMD, ale wtedy mamy do czynienia z zmodyfikowanym
distrybucją (np.Iatkos) i ich instalacja niestety może stwarzać różne
problemy
– Płyta Retail wraz z systemem MacOSx, płyta dołączona do jakiego
kolwiek komputera Apple, nie będzie działać poprawnie, proponuje Snow
Leoparda 10.6.0.
– Napęd DVD oraz dysk “SATA”
– Kilka czystych płytek CD, aby zainstalować BootCD na nich
– Karta graficzna Intel/ATI
– Odpowiednio przygotowany dysk sformatowany na FAT32
– Mysz, klawiatura USB, z PS/2 mogą występować kłopoty
– Ogólna wiedza o naszym sprzęcie (chipset karty dźwiękowej, sieciowej
itp. Wi-Fi od Intela nie działa)
– Coś do picia
Przed przystąpieniem do jakichkolwiek prac:
–
W biosie zmieniamy tryb pracy dysku na AHCI (Jeżeli występuje Still
Waiting for Root Device, odznaczamy i odwrotnie)
– Odłączamy wszelkie urządzenia peryferyjne (drukarki etc.)
– Przeczytaj chociaż raz to co napisałem
Daj sobie spokój z instalacją gdy:
–
Posiadasz laptopa z mobilną grafiką Radeona
– Nie umiem zainstalować winzgrozy (czyt. windowsa)
Zaczynamy
Wkładamy płytkę z BootCD do napędu i czekamy, aż się wczyta. Gdy
płytka zostanie wczytana (max 3 minuty) wysuwamy ją z napedu i
wkładamy płytkę z systemem MacOSx. Po odczekamiu około 30 sekund
wciskamy klawisz F5. Gdy płyta z systemem zostanie wczytana
uruchamiamy system z parametrami -v -f busratio=xx (parametr busratio
jest zależny od modelu procesora) cpus=1 (gdy występują aliasy biosie,
wtedy system nie łapie “bootloop’a”).
Jeżeli nie zobaczymy okna wyboru języka (patrz poniżej) można
przypuszczać, że system nieprawidłowo rozpoznał naszą kartę graficzną
można dopisać parametr GraphicsEnabler=yes PciRoot=x (zazwycaj z
biosem: award wartość PciRoot=1, a dla phoenix x=0)
Proponuje wybrać język angielski, dopiero później doinstalować język
polski ręcznie, gdyż niekiedy występują problemy z aplikacjami
spowodowane złym tłumaczeniem.Następnym krokiem będzie wybranie z
narzędzi, narzędzia dyskowego (Disk Utility).
Następnie musimy kliknąć w dysk docelowy i wybrać zakładkę “Partycja”
Wybieramy interesującą nas opcję (liczba partycji, rozmiar, etc.). Dysk
powinien być ma mapie parttcji “GUID”, lecz gdy wybierzemy “MBR”,
system nie powinien strzelać fochów.
Ważne: Partycja pod OS’a musi być sformatowana w “Mac OS X Extended
(Journaled)”Teraz zamykamy narzędzia dyskowe, i zabieramy się za
następną część instalacji. Po drodze musimy zaakceptować licencję.
Nawiasem mówiąc instalacja systemu MacOSx jest w polsce legalna.
Łamiemy jedynie EULA
i nie mamy prawa do żadnego supportu od Steva Jobsa.
Podczas gdy klikamy sobie dalej, i dojdziemy do końca to wyskoczy nam
okienko w którym wybieramy miejsce gdzie zostanie zainstalowany system
w moim przypadku Snow Leopard 10.6.0. Jeżeli zależy nam na 15 minut
krótszej instalacji polecałbym kliknąć w “Dostosuj” i odznaczyć wszystko.
Gdy zrobimy to wszytko co zostało wyżej opisane proponowałbym kliknąć
“Instaluj”. Operacja ta może potrwać do ok. 40 min. W tym czasie
spożywamy nasze trunki.Gdy komputer się uruchomi ponownie wkładamy
mu płytę z BootCD, wybieramy partycję z systemem i odpalamy z tymi
samymi parametrami, jak podczas instalacji. Jeżeli wszystko jest ok, nie
wyskoczył nam żaden Kernel Panic. Przykładowy KP:
Jeżeli wszystko przebiegło pomyślnie powinniśmy zobaczyć film powitalny.
Dopieszczanie systemu
Chyba najłatwiejszą metodą będzie pobranie aplikacji “Multibeast”
instalacja jest intuicyjna, ale możemy wszystko popsuć czytamy opisy
wszystkiego co instalujemy. Obowiązkowo musimy zainstalować:
-EasyBeast Install
-Jeżeli mamy mysz lub klawiaturę PS/2 i któreś z nich nie działa to
VoodooPS/2 dostępny w Drivers & Bootloaders
-Bootloader Chameleon
Aby sprawdzić czy nasza grafika działa wystarczy spojrzeć czy nasz pasek
u góry jest przezroczysty. Aby się upewnić klikamy PPM gdzieś na pulpicie i
wybieramy opcje zmiana grafiki. Tam pod obrazkami powinna być
zaznaczona opcja przezroczysty pasek (czy cos takiego z pamięci piszę).
Jeżeli pasek jest biały to mamy kilka możliwości:- GraphicsEnabler=yes
PciRoot=x (wyjaśniałem wcześniej, wielkość liter ma znaczenie)
– Używamy NVEnabler.kext, można pobrać z kexts.com, kexty instalujemy
za pomocą Kext Utility. Jeżeli nie działa to usuwamy ten kext (sterownik)
znajduję się on w katalogu /System/Library/Extra/
– Injector od netcasa
– Generujemy EFI String za pomocą programu EFI Studio
– Dopisujemy grafikę do tablic DSDT (tablice ACPI, będzie o nich mowa w
innych tutorialach)
WAŻNE: Każdą metodę testujemy oddzielnie, gdyż mogą one
powodować KP.
Instalujemy kexty od dźwięku większość kart obsługuje LegalcyHDA. To jest
chyba wszystko, aby system działał. Można, a nawet należy wykonać
jeszcze kopię systemu za pomocą Time Machine.
Byłbym zapomniał uruchamiamy program DSDT Patcher, i klikamy Run
DSDT Patcher. Generuje on tablice DSDT, nanosi poprawki i je zapisuje.
Jeżeli jest problem z wyłączaniem się systemu, restartem należy
zainstalować EvOreboot.kext. Instalujemy Combo Update (jeśli chcemy
mieć “bieżący” system.
Nie korzystamy z Software Update, gdyż jest przyczyną KP niekiedy).
Instalacja tego systemu to temat rzeka, chętnie odpowiem na każde
pytania w komentarzach.
Download:
BootCD: http://blog.nawcom.com/?p=266#more-266
MultiBeast: http://www.tonymacx86.com/viewforum.php?f=69/
Combo Update: http://support.apple.com/kb/dl1349
Kext Utility: http://www.insanelymac.com/forum/index.php?
showtopic=140647
Wszelakie kexty znajdziemy na kexts.com
Artykuł napisany przez Tomka Sieradzkiego.